Campy triple left lever on a double drivetrain?
Can you use a Campy 11 speed triple left shifter on a double drivetrain?
I would think it's just a matter of setting the FD limit screws but you never know... |

Yes...use the first clicks to get the chain onto the big ring, then limit screw to prevent the last click(s) of the LH lever.

2007-compact cranks introduced..Centaur and Veloce became 'Escape' innards and double only. All others, still double or triple for the LH lever. 2009-Gumby shape, 11s BUT all levers are now 'UltraShift', for doubles but I have used an older Racing T and Comp triple front der on triple cranks..with the 11s levers as well. SR/Record/Chorus-11s..all others 10s 2011-SR/Record/Chorus stay Ultrashift so can be used with a triple FD but all below become 'Powershift(Escape innards) so double only. Athena comes back in 2011 but still 'Escape' and double only. 2013-Athena triple back, still 'Escape' but it WILL shift a double front der and crank. BUT, back to the OP..yes, a Campag shifter designated as 'triple', like those with escape innards(one higher gear at a time with RH thumb button) will work with a double front der and crank.
